Abstract
In a heat exchanger comprising a plurality of first heat-transfer elements (A) for a fluid of higher temperature and second heat-transfer elements (B) for a fluid of lower temperature joined alternately and adjacently and a suitable number of appropriately shaped fins disposed within said elements and wherein the heat exchange is performed between the fluid (a) of higher temperature and the fluid (b) of lower temperature and at least the fluid (a) is changed in phase during the heat exchange, the improvement of providing such a heat exchanger with the ability to rectify the condensate from the fluid (a) and to recover the rectified liquid, wherein the fins in the lower part of the element (A) are so arranged that the fluid (a) entering from a port into the element (A) flows upwards smoothly with contact with the liquid condensed from the fluid (a) at the upper part of the element (A), which flows down through the heat exchanger. The condensed liquid flows down through the fins and is taken out from a port provided at the lowest part of the element (A). Accordingly, condensation of a gaseous fluid and rectification of the resulting condensate are both performed with high efficiency in the same apparatus.
